I have been using IG Markets for my 5 minute trades which I rarely actually place any since I focus on 1 hour more.. Anyway the point is their US based FOREX branch is closing. I used them mainly for the charts as I have said and thats because:

1) They updated very quickly in real time
2) They seemed to be very accurate in comparison to some charting packages ive seen
3) They allow me to use pretty much any indicators I want and I havent hit a limitation with them yet
4) And this is the main one.. They allowed me to save my charts setup on my screen as a template. Now I do not mean they let me save a template of what I wanted to use.. which is standard now.. What was special was that I could take 6 charts and space them out evenly across my screen and save the template.. then by hitting a hot key (f1 - f12) they would open in the exact place I saved them. This means I could hit f6 for my 5 minute charts with ema and f10 for my custom idicator 1 hour and then f1 for a different set of charts.. etc...

Basically I was able to view as many charts as I wanted to spread out on my screen and I could switch to other charts to do the same with ease. Also I didn't have to reset them up every time it was just saved.

I had charts setup this way for everything from 5 minute with ema indicators to daily with whatever custom indicator. I could just easily switch between everything with 1 button.

The fact is, is that I cant find anything else like this. Anyone know of any good charting packages with something similar?

The differences are likely due to different source data (bar data). It is possible that some formulas are different for the indicator itself, but more likely to be the data.
